![]() ![]() Many big companies have euro or dollar-denominated loans, and their repayment in the coming months may pose problems with the devaluation of the Turkish currency, analysts warned. in this context, the lira will not be returning to former levels," independent Economist Mustafa Sonmez told Xinhua. ![]() ![]() "In the upcoming 12 months period, Turkey has to repay (external) debts amounting to $167 billion, thus it needs foreign currency. Turkey's large short-term external debts and low foreign currency reserves mean that it is one of the most vulnerable emerging markets to tighter external financing conditions.
